ABSTRACT:
A process is provided for preparing the keto-phosphonate ##STR1## in enantiomerically homogeneous form, by reacting the anhydride ##STR2## with S-.alpha.-methylbenzylamine to effect diastereoselective opening of the anhydride to give a mixture of amides ##STR3## separating the amides, for example, by frictional crystallization, and converting the desired amide IVA (which is obtained in high yield from the anhydride) to enantiomerically homogeneous ketophosphonate in high yield and on a large scale.
The so-formed ketophosphonate is useful in the synthesis of compactin as well as 7-substituted-(3,5-dihydroxy)-hept-6-enoic and -heptanoic acid HMG-CoA reductase inhibitors.
